Emirates and NBA Cares Deliver Lasting Community Legacy for San Antonio Youth

(NEWS) SAN ANTONIO, TX, United States, 2026-Jun-5 — /Travel PR News/ — Sports partnerships increasingly extend beyond branding and sponsorship rights, with major leagues and corporate partners investing in community projects designed to leave a lasting impact in host cities. Ahead of the NBA Finals, one such initiative has taken shape in San Antonio through a collaboration between Emirates and the NBA.

Emirates, the Official Airline Partner of the NBA, has partnered with NBA Cares to unveil a newly renovated gymnasium and multi-purpose room at The Denver Heights Community Centre (DHCC) in San Antonio, Texas. The project forms part of the NBA Cares Finals Legacy Projects programme, which focuses on creating long-term community benefits in cities hosting major NBA events.

In a press update highlighted by Emirates, the upgraded facility was officially opened during a ribbon-cutting ceremony attended by representatives from Emirates, the NBA, the San Antonio Spurs and local government officials, alongside young people from the community centre who will use the new facilities.

The refurbishment included improvements to the gymnasium and multi-purpose room, featuring new fitness equipment, scoreboards, backboards, flooring, graphics and other upgrades designed to create a more modern recreational environment. The multi-purpose space has also been equipped with updated technology and gaming equipment.

The Denver Heights Community Centre serves local youth and families through recreational, educational and community programmes, providing access to safe spaces and activities that support personal development and wellbeing.

As part of the initiative, Emirates distributed backpacks from its Aircrafted by Emirates programme to participating children. The bags are produced using repurposed seat fabric from the airline’s ongoing aircraft retrofit programme and include co-branded Emirates and NBA merchandise. According to Emirates, nearly 4,000 Aircrafted for Kids backpacks have been donated to schools and community organisations worldwide.

Following the official opening, local youth participated in a Jr. NBA and Jr. WNBA basketball clinic to celebrate the completion of the project.

The initiative reflects the broader relationship between Emirates and the NBA. In addition to serving as the league’s Official Global Airline Partner, Emirates is also the title partner of the Emirates NBA Cup and a presenting partner of this year’s NBA Cares Finals Legacy Projects.

For Emirates, community-focused programmes have become an increasingly visible component of its global sports sponsorship strategy, complementing partnerships across basketball, football, rugby, tennis and other major sports.
